Transaction ab127ea1443880ab79bb430798eb36b3ebfb0e28933c268d11eae4a06014e85d

1 Input
2 Outputs
  • ab127ea1443880ab79bb430798eb36b3ebfb0e28933c268d11eae4a06014e85d:0
  • value  1057000
    address  12kzrhS6vNJjpPS2HPDNXkvjE1KqEJaGdD
  • ab127ea1443880ab79bb430798eb36b3ebfb0e28933c268d11eae4a06014e85d:1
  • value  335842428
    address  bc1qh74y2g02vtupf0ys532tf8rgl0dk46hhuqul2m